This past month we held our 2nd annual SCAVENGER HUNT. Our run started at SideWinders and ended at Punkin Center. Along the way the riders visited some of our business members and collected skeleton parts to complete the run. While at Punkin Center we had people looking for body parts hidden all over the place with clues leading the way. We also had a pumpkin decorating contest with sharpie markers. There was just one trick, you had to decorate the pumpkin blindfolded. We had a lot of fun and we missed you if you couldn’t make it. We’ll see you next year at this same event.
Our next big event will be our Birds on Bikes and with the help of Safeway we’ll deliver 20 Thanksgiving dinners to family’s who could use a little help. This event will be held in the Safeway parking lot on November 22nd starting at 9:00 am. While we are doing our good deeds for our community, we’ll be doing other good deeds by setting up a motorcycle safety and awareness booth. Hundreds of people will receive good quality information about motorcycle safety and awareness. Here in the Rim District, we also like to focus on children by giving them LOOK OUT FOR MOTORCYCLES free t- shirts and balloons.
This year our Christmas party will be held at Cactus Flats on December 6th beginning at 12:00 pm. Please bring a toy for a child and a unisex gift for our gift exchange amongst our members. The toys brought for the children of our community are the true focus of this event. All the toys that are donated go directly to the children of our community. With lots of games, food, 50/50, raffles, and lots of prizes, we’re looking forward to collecting a lot of toys for the kids.
